Subject: [PATCH] Staging: iio: dummy: Fix blank line warnings
Date: Fri, 10 Jul 2015 17:10:21 +0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20150710141021.GA7015@Inspiron> (raw)
Multiple blank lines should not be used as indicated by checkpatch.pl.
Also, a line should be used after a function/structure declaration.
